4 Pressure Gauge Selection Considerations in Selecting a Pressure Gauge 4 RANGE The maximum operating pressure should not exceed 75% of the full-scale range.

If higher temperatures are encountered the gauge must be isolated from the source of heat. The temperature of the media to which the gauge is subjected to is also critical. Gauges with phosphor bronze Bourdon tubes should not be subjected to process temperatures in excess of 150 F.

5 Gauges with metal cases and either 316 stainless steel or monel bourdons can withstand higher process temperatures, but as temperature exceeds 150 F hardening of the gasketing and discoloration of the dial may occur. In addition, accuracy will be affected by approximately per 100 F. 6 000 psi 0/1000 psi 50 psi STANDARD RANGES STANDARD RANGES26 NOTES: (1) The accuracy of measurement is influenced by the ambient temperature. The Weksler test gauge is calibrated to be accurate to within 1 4 of 1% of full scale range at 77 F. (25 C). Using the gauge in ambient temperatures other than this requires the application of a correction of of the indicated Pressure for each 1 F.
